- [ ] **Whisperhall audio-guide v3.2:** double-check the offline tour packs actually play after airplane-mode toggle — the Marquessa Wing pack kept stalling last week. QA signed off Tuesday but let's not jinx it. Before we ship to the kiosk tablets, everyone confirm you're testing the build matching the token below.

build token for yajof-bajof: htk31_506ff1188f74596b5bb2eec94edc43c

- [ ] **Step 7: Breaker override escrow.** After sealing the signing keys for the Tallgrove upstream API circuit breaker, confirm the support team can force the breaker open during a full outage. The override bundle lives in the sealed escrow drawer and is useless without its unlock phrase. Two ceremony witnesses must initial this step before proceeding. The escrow bundle is decrypted with the recovery passphrase that follows.

vault phrase of kahip-kahop = holath-quenmir

Management Meeting Minutes — Inventory Write-Down

Present: Dara, Olen, Priya (chair). Main item: the slow-moving Harvaline components sitting in the Bexworth warehouse. We agreed they're not shifting, so finance will book a write-down this quarter rather than dragging it out. Olen to confirm the final figure with the auditors; Dara to flag the hit in the forecast. Next review in four weeks. The confidential note on forward plans appears below.

management briefing: Only 3 of the 140 pilot accounts renewed Oliix, so a churn review is set for July 1.

## Data Stores — Perchline Sidecar

The Perchline metrics-aggregation sidecar runs beside each Hollowgate service pod. It buffers counters in memory for 15 seconds, then flushes rollups to the aggregation store. No raw request payloads are retained; only dimension tags and numeric values cross the boundary. Flush failures are retried with jittered backoff and dropped after five attempts. For audit purposes, the sidecar writes to the store reachable via the following string.

primary connection of tawif-yajeg = postgresql://rusiel_svc:G879q9cx6GsSvj@db-dd9f.norvagrid.internal:5432/casath